This individual is an English internet personality primarily known for gaming content on YouTube. Launched a channel focusing on Minecraft gameplay, tutorials, and creative challenges. Collaborated with other popular creators in the gaming community and gained significant recognition for engaging content and personality. Consistently produced videos that resonate with a large audience, which contributed to a substantial follower base across multiple platforms.

Created a highly popular Minecraft YouTube channel

Collaborated with Dream on the Dream SMP

Achieved millions of subscribers on YouTube

Born in 1932, this individual played in the National Hockey League (NHL) primarily for the Detroit Red Wings and New York Rangers. Transitioning to coaching, led the New York Islanders to four consecutive Stanley Cup championships from 1980 to 1983. The coaching tenure included several successful seasons and the establishment of a prominent team in the league. After retiring, served as a consultant and remained involved in hockey operations.

A prominent basketball player and coach, achieved significant success in both roles. Played for Old Dominion University, leading the team to an AIAW national championship in 1980. Represented the United States in international competitions, contributing to the team's success in the 1984 Olympics, where the team won a gold medal. Transitioned to coaching, including notable positions at Seton Hall, East Carolina University, and George Washington University, and served as an assistant for the U.S. women's national team, winning a gold medal at the 2010 FIBA World Championship. Inducted into the Women's Basketball Hall of Fame in 1999.
